India’s left-arm spinner Kuldeep Yadav has been released from the ongoing T20I series in Australia to join the India A squad for their second four-day match against South Africa A in Bengaluru. The decision was announced by the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) on Sunday, just after India’s five-wicket win over Australia in Hobart. According to the BCCI, the move aims to give Kuldeep valuable red-ball match practice ahead of the upcoming two-match Test series against South Africa later this month. The second India A vs South Africa A match begins on November 6 at the BCCI Centre of Excellence in Bengaluru. Kuldeep, who has been in good form in white-ball cricket, will now focus on adapting to longer formats. His inclusion in the India A squad allows him to prepare for potential Test selection and maintain rhythm in red-ball conditions. BCCI confirms strategic move “The Indian team management has requested to release Kuldeep Yadav from the ongoing T20I series in Australia to allow him to participate in the India A series against South Africa A,” the BCCI said in a statement. “The decision has been taken to provide Kuldeep with red-ball game time in preparation for the upcoming Test series against South Africa.” India currently trail Australia 1-1 in the five-match T20I series. The team bounced back strongly in the second match, led by Washington Sundar’s explosive unbeaten 49 and Arshdeep Singh’s early breakthroughs, earning India a solid five-wicket win in Hobart.
